Find out more »Cumberland Health Care Careers Bursary Program
If you are a Cumberland County student pursuing a career in health care, you have until Fri, May 26th to apply for a 2017 bursary from the Cumberland Health Care Careers Bursary Program. Successful applicants receive a bursary of up to $5000 per year to support their studies and must sign a “return for service” commitment upon graduation equal to the number of years for which they receive a bursary.
